1. Application of electromagnetic flowmeter in the field of water treatment
Electromagnetic flowmeter is an instrument that measures liquid flow based on Faraday’s law of electromagnetic induction. It has a wide measurement range, high accuracy and good stability, easy maintenance and other advantages. In the field of water treatment, electromagnetic flowmeters are widely used and can be used to measure the flow of various liquids such as tap water, wastewater, drinking water, seawater, etc.
2. Why electromagnetic flowmeter can be used to measure tap water
Tap water refers to The water processed by water plants and supplied to residents and businesses has high water quality requirements, and flow stability is also very important. The electromagnetic flowmeter can calculate the flow rate by measuring the electromagnetic induction intensity in the conductive liquid. The higher the ion concentration in the conductive liquid, the greater the electromagnetic induction intensity, and vice versa. Since tap water contains a variety of ions that can conduct electricity, electromagnetic flowmeters can be used to measure tap water.
3. Advantages and precautions of using electromagnetic flowmeter to measure tap water
The advantages of using electromagnetic flowmeter to measure tap water mainly include the following points:
1. It has a wide measurement range and can be applied to tap water pipes of various diameters and flows.
2. It has high accuracy and can meet the accuracy requirements of tap water flow measurement.
3. It has good stability and can operate stably for a long time without being affected by changes in water quality.
4. It is easy to maintain and can be checked and repaired online.
When using an electromagnetic flowmeter to measure tap water, you need to pay attention to the following points:
1. The installation location must be reasonable, and installation at elbows, valves, etc. should be avoided.
2. Calibration should be performed before use to ensure the accuracy of measurement data.
3. Avoid bubbles, sediments, etc. appearing in the water, which will affect the measurement accuracy of the electromagnetic flowmeter.
In short, electromagnetic flowmeter can be applied to the measurement of tap water and has broad application prospects and unique performance advantages. When using it, you need to pay attention to the above related matters to ensure the accuracy and stability of the measurement.
